Get to know RuPaul's Drag Race Season 8 queens

8 - Season 8 Queens

The eighth season of RuPaul’s Drag Race is due to begin in a few weeks, and Ru wants you to get to know the girls a little better before the battle begins.

In a new video from Logo TV, the girls play a game of word association and give you a peep into the depths of their charisma, uniqueness, nerve and talent.

This season, RuPaul promises to head back to her roots, showing off a kitschy ’50s salon themed set in the campy promo.
